Transaction 2c6068598539acc958a667e3cc5e896e6277a821e4cb61fde6534b740f46275b

1 Input
2 Outputs
  • 2c6068598539acc958a667e3cc5e896e6277a821e4cb61fde6534b740f46275b:0
  • value  40902296
    address  1Gu4HhaNmNKT5YchhHYAmV96goyoMX5Qr9
  • 2c6068598539acc958a667e3cc5e896e6277a821e4cb61fde6534b740f46275b:1
  • value  2892478
    address  1ChBS46prtbTqzaX5m7BbYVkV1jHUD6PGF